Scarf: Transforming Lives through Hospitality
Scarf is a social enterprise that has been making waves in Melbourne's hospitality industry. The company partners with some of the city's best restaurants to provide training, mentoring, and paid work experience to young people who are seeking protection or come from refugee and migrant backgrounds. Scarf's mission is simple yet powerful: to transform lives through hospitality.
The Scarf program is designed to help young people overcome barriers to employment by providing them with the skills, knowledge, and experience they need to succeed in the hospitality industry. The program consists of three main components: training, mentoring, and paid work experience.
Training
Scarf trainees receive comprehensive training in all aspects of hospitality, including customer service, food preparation and presentation, hygiene and safety standards, and teamwork. The training is delivered by experienced professionals who are passionate about sharing their knowledge with the next generation of hospitality workers.
Mentoring
In addition to formal training sessions, Scarf trainees also receive one-on-one mentoring from industry professionals. Mentors provide guidance on everything from career planning to personal development. They help trainees build confidence and self-esteem while also providing practical advice on how to succeed in the workplace.
Paid Work Experience
Perhaps most importantly, Scarf provides its trainees with paid work experience at some of Melbourne's top restaurants. This gives them an opportunity to put their newly acquired skills into practice while also earning a wage. It also helps them build connections within the industry that can lead to future employment opportunities.
Impact
Since its inception in 2010, Scarf has helped over 300 young people gain valuable skills and experience in the hospitality industry. Many have gone on to secure permanent employment or start their own businesses within the sector.
But Scarf's impact goes beyond just helping individuals find jobs; it also helps break down barriers between different communities within Melbourne. By bringing together people from diverse backgrounds around a shared love of food and hospitality, Scarf is helping to build a more inclusive and connected city.
